The Opportunity                                            

The Citizen Developer Community Lead is responsible for building and sustaining the programs, experiences, and connections that grow MetLife's global maker community — from onboarding and training to engagement and capability development — across MetLife's worldwide functions and regions. This is an exciting opportunity to serve as the connective tissue between executive sponsors, regional COE teams, and citizen developers on the ground, directly shaping how thousands of employees learn, collaborate, and innovate with low-code and AI tools.

Key Responsibilities

    Own end-to-end community management for the Citizen Developer program, serving as the primary point of contact for community engagement across all levels—from executive sponsors and business leaders to individual makers and champions.

  • Design and deliver training programs, learning pathways, and onboarding experiences that build citizen developer capability at scale, ensuring content remains current with evolving platform features and best practices.
  • Drive ongoing community engagement through regular programming—including newsletters, forums, events, and recognition initiatives—that sustain participation, surface peer insights, and reinforce a culture of shared learning.
  • Build and manage the citizen developer champions network, recruiting and enabling advocates within business units who can extend community reach and provide on-the-ground support across regions.
  • Track community health and engagement metrics, sharing insights with the Global COE Lead and relevant stakeholders, and using data to continuously improve programs, identify gaps, and demonstrate the value of the citizen developer community.

Required Qualifications                                      

  • Bachelor’s degree in Information Technology, Communications, or a related field—or equivalent practical experience.
  • 3+ years of experience in community management, platform enablement, end-user adoption or a related role within a technology organization — including hands-on experience with AI-powered tools.
  • Hands-on experience with Microsoft Power Platform (Copilot Studio, Power Automate, Power Apps), including a solid understanding of underlying AI concepts such as large language models, prompt design, and how AI-native features are applied within low-code environments.
  • Demonstrated ability to design and deliver training programs, workshops, or learning experiences for techn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Strong communication and stakeholder engagement skills, with the ability to build relationships across business units, regions, and seniority levels—from frontline makers to executive sponsors.

Preferred Qualifications

           Prior experience operating within or supporting a Center of Excellence (COE), including familiarity with governance frameworks, intake processes, and federated team models.

  • Working knowledge of enterprise AI, automation, and digital transformation trends, including familiarity with key AI tools and LLM-based platforms, and the ability to translate these concepts into clear, actionable guidance for non-technical citizen developers.
  • Experience using community platforms, learning management systems, or collaboration tools (e.g., Viva Engage, SharePoint, Teams) to manage and scale digital communities.

                                                                                                                                                                                          Location Expectation: This is a hybrid role requiring a minimum of 3 days per week in office.

  

The expected salary range for this position is  $100,000 - $130,000. This role may also be eligible for annual short-term incentive compensation and stock-based long-term incentives. All incentives and benefits are subject to the applicable plan terms.
